Pump motor operates but the room does not move:
• Check the two fuses adjacent to the hydraulic pump. If the fuses
test good and the room does not operate, it is possible to manually
retract a single galley slide. Dual galley slide-outs use different
hydraulic components. Several people (as many as eight) are needed
to push in the room.
• It may be necessary to contact a repair facility to have the problem
diagnosed.
To move the slide-out room manually:
1. Retract the motorhome leveling jacks (see "Leveling Jacks").
2. Locate the slide-out room hydraulic pump on the lower left front
frame of the chassis.
3. Turn the T-Handles counterclockwise approximately six turns each.
The T-Handles may turn easily at first; however; they will become
difficult to turn as the internal springs are compressed. The room
may move slightly as the valves are opened and internal pressure
is released.
4. Line up equal distance along the outside wall. Do not push on the
flange.
5. In synchronized movements, push the room in with repeated
attempts.
6. Close the T-handles when the room is fully retracted.
NOTE: The slide-out room is heavy and will require several persons
to push it into the retracted position. When the slide-out room is in
the fully retracted position tighten the T-Handles to hold the room in
place.
